Bad Zwischenahn: Intoxicated friends try to pick each other up from the police station

2022-01-18T02:48:16.789Z


A man was supposed to pick up his stoned friend from the police station in Bad Zwischenahn – but he was under the influence of drugs himself. A third potential pick-up also appeared at the station unfit to drive.

In Lower Saxony, several intoxicated friends tried to pick each other up from a police station. On Monday evening, the police in Bad Zwischenahn near Oldenburg found during a vehicle check that the driver was under the influence of drugs. According to the announcement, a preliminary test suggested cannabis. The police took the driver to the police station for a blood test. Because he was forbidden to continue driving, the driver called a friend to pick him up.

When he came to the station in his own car, he also appeared intoxicated, according to the police.

A drug test showed amphetamines and he also had to give a blood sample.

So now both friends were stuck at the station, which is why they informed a third friend.

When he entered the station, according to the statement, the officers “were amazed” – because he was also not roadworthy.

"It had to be stopped now," the police said.

Since no reliable driver could be organized, the officers took the car keys of the first alleged collector into official custody.

"Clear words followed," it said.

The three officers promised that they would “present a suitable driver the following day”.
